
Eggplants with pork
Description
This recipe for eggplants with pork is great because it makes a complete dish that can serve as lunch or dinner for the whole family. If desired, you can also add some cheese to create a delicious, crispy topping.
Instructions
- 1
Step 1

1. Wash the eggplants, dry them, and slice into rounds. Lightly salt and let stand for 10-15 minutes. Then rinse thoroughly and dry well. This will remove the bitterness from the eggplants.
- 2
Step 2

2. Sprinkle the eggplants with vegetable oil and place them on a baking sheet or in a baking dish. Put in the preheated oven for about 20 minutes.
- 3
Step 3

3. Wash the pork and pass it through a meat grinder. Transfer to a frying pan and fry for 10-15 minutes. Add a little salt and spices. Stir occasionally during cooking to prevent lumps from forming.
- 4
Step 4

4. Peel the garlic and chop it finely with a knife or press it through a garlic press. The recipe for eggplants with pork can also be supplemented with chopped onion, carrot, and sweet pepper, for example.
- 5
Step 5

5. Place the garlic in a frying pan with a small amount of vegetable oil. Meanwhile, wash the tomatoes and peel off their skins. Cut the tomatoes into small cubes and add them to the pan. Season lightly with salt to taste and add a little spice if desired. Simmer the sauce briefly to remove excess moisture. Wash and dry the basil, then add it to the tomato sauce at the end of cooking.
- 6
Step 6

6. The tomato sauce needs to be thoroughly cooled. Separately beat 4 eggs and then add the cooled sauce to them (this is important, as the eggs may curdle if the sauce is hot). Mix well.
- 7
Step 7

7. Place the eggplants on the bottom of a heatproof dish. Add a little pork and tomato sauce on top. Depending on the size of the dish, repeat the layers several times. Put the dish in the preheated oven.
- 8
Step 8

8. Eggplants with pork prepared at home take 45 to 70 minutes. Before serving, the finished dish can be sprinkled with olive oil and fresh basil.
